The VALUE COLLECTION 365-0059 is a hex rethreading die designed to restore damaged or corroded external threads on fasteners and threaded rod. It cuts a 2-56 Unified National Coarse (UNC) thread profile in the right-hand direction, making it suitable for cleanup work on small-diameter screws and machine threads. Machined from carbon steel, the die delivers the hardness needed to cut through minor thread damage without deforming under normal hand-tool torque. Technicians in HVAC, electrical, and general mechanical service use rethreading dies as a fast field repair alternative to replacing threaded fasteners outright.
This die is used in residential and commercial maintenance scenarios where small machine screw threads have been stripped, cross-threaded, or corroded. The 2-56 size covers a range of fine-pitch fasteners found in control panels, electrical enclosures, and light mechanical assemblies. It is installed by hand using a standard hex die holder or tap-and-die wrench, making it practical for bench work or on-site service calls.

A licensed mechanic or trained technician should de-energize and lock out any equipment before performing thread repair on fasteners in live assemblies. Secure the workpiece in a vise or fixture before applying the die to ensure straight thread engagement. Apply cutting oil to extend die life and produce a cleaner thread profile. Inspect the restored thread with a mating nut before returning the fastener to service.
